上一页 1 ··· 8 9 10 11 12 13 14 15 16 ··· 26 下一页
摘要: 要求:用单片机实现一个电子密码锁的功能,一开始设置密码,设置从0-f,任意多少位密码(只要不超过十位),设置成功,蜂鸣器响一下;接着是验证密码,如果输入错误三次,则暂停一段时间,不允许使用,如果输入成功(F键确认),则密码解锁,步进电机转动,如果按下E键,则停止转动。连线:P0键盘,P2倒着接数码管,P3.0接蜂鸣器,P1接步进电机/*****************************键盘码的顺序**********************************//* 0xee,0xde,0xbe,0x7e 0-3 ... 阅读全文
posted @ 2013-06-07 18:05 蓬莱仙羽 阅读(523) 评论(0) 推荐(0)
摘要: 作为当前最主流的3D游戏引擎之一,Unity拥有大量第三方插件和工具帮助开发者提升工作效率。我们摘选了十款最受欢迎的工具推荐给大家,类别包括2D开发、UI设计、原型制作、着色、特效等,涉及了游戏开发最主要的十个方面。1. 2D Toolkit如果过去你一直从事3D游戏开发,最近想转做2D游戏,最好尝试一下2D Toolkit。2D Toolkit是一款2D开发组件,它具有很强的灵活性和适应性,能够让开发者在Unity环境中进行2D开发。2D Toolkit2D Toolkit基本没有学习门槛,拥有可编写脚本的动画编辑器以及具有Unity平台特性的组件集合,能够对像素进行完美呈现。2D Tool 阅读全文
posted @ 2013-06-04 19:05 蓬莱仙羽 阅读(730) 评论(0) 推荐(0)
该文被密码保护。 阅读全文
posted @ 2013-06-04 15:22 蓬莱仙羽 阅读(1) 评论(0) 推荐(0)
摘要: 连线:P1.6接蜂鸣器#include #define uchar unsigned char #define uint unsigned int sbit BEEP=P3^7; //生日快乐歌的音符频率表,不同频率由不同的延时来决定uchar code SONG_TONE[]={212,212,190,212,159,169,212,212,190,212,142,159,212,212,106,126,159,169,190,119,119,126,159,142,159,0}; //生日快乐歌节拍表,节拍决定每个音符的演奏长短uchar code SONG_LONG[]={9,3,12, 阅读全文
posted @ 2013-06-04 15:19 蓬莱仙羽 阅读(551) 评论(0) 推荐(0)
该文被密码保护。 阅读全文
posted @ 2013-06-04 15:18 蓬莱仙羽 阅读(6) 评论(0) 推荐(0)
摘要: 今天最开心事情莫过于摸索验证了一个事情,C#也能进行Android和IOS开发,白天安装了开发环境,晚上进行测试,直到此时此刻,已经成功的导出一款基于C#/.NET的安卓APK,并且能够成功的导入到安卓手机运行,这对于我们一向忠迷于C#/.NET的开发者来说是多么激动和欣慰事情。通过此次试验完成,成功的打破了安卓不仅仅只是java才能开发,IOS也不仅仅只是Objective-C才能开发,还有一点就是验证了C#/.NET不仅仅只能跑到微软自己 系统行,从Mono跨平台开发环境问世后,掌握好C#语言,能够开发多种平台的应用软件,以后可以用C#开发安卓,iphone适合自己的应用软件,这是多么开. 阅读全文
posted @ 2013-06-03 01:33 蓬莱仙羽 阅读(2295) 评论(4) 推荐(0)
摘要: 要求:数码管从0开始显示,按一次按键(和内部中断,每隔一秒就自然进入中断一次),进入一次中断,数码管上数字加1,直到999,又从0开始。连线:P10连L7 电位器连直流电机 脉冲输出连P32 CS1连数码管CS#include<reg51.h>typedef unsigned char uchar;xdata uchar LED_CS _at_ 0x9000;xdata uchar LED_OUTSEG _at_ 0x9004;xdata uchar LED_OUTBIT _at_ 0x9002;sbit P10=P1^0;uchar n=0;unsigned int Count= 阅读全文
posted @ 2013-05-30 17:24 蓬莱仙羽 阅读(839) 评论(0) 推荐(0)
摘要: 要求:利用DA转化产生几种不同的波形,例如三角波,锯齿波等等#include <reg52.h>#define uchar unsigned char#define uint unsigned int#define juchi 0#define fangbo 1#define sanjiao 2#define zhengxian 3uchar xdata DA_CS _at_ 0xA000; uint i;uchar tag;void delay(int ms){ int i,j; for(i = 0;i < 50;i++) for(j = 0;j < 60;j+... 阅读全文
posted @ 2013-05-28 22:59 蓬莱仙羽 阅读(338) 评论(0) 推荐(0)
摘要: 功能说明:PWM,通过改变占空比,PWM_T/100,这里100是周期,每个按键都会给PWM_T一个定值,这样就改变了输出波形。#include<reg52.h>sbit P10=P1^0;unsigned char i;void delay(unsigned char n){unsigned char i,j;for(i=0;i<n;i++) for(j=0;j<20;j++);}void ex0() interrupt 0{i+=10;}void main(){ EX0=1; IT0=1; EA=1; i=150; while(1) { P10=0; delay(i 阅读全文
posted @ 2013-05-28 22:56 蓬莱仙羽 阅读(869) 评论(0) 推荐(0)
摘要: 要求:实现蜂鸣器响。连线:将P3^4连接到蜂鸣器上原理:在蜂鸣器上加上一个不断0,1变化的信号,就能实现蜂鸣器响的效果#include<reg51.h>sbit beep=P3^4;char count;bit flag;void latetime(int t){ char j; while(t--) { for(j=0;j<20;j++); }}void init(){ TMOD=0x01; TH0=(65535-50000)/256; TL0=(65535-50000)%256; TR0=1; ET0=1; EA=1... 阅读全文
posted @ 2013-05-28 22:50 蓬莱仙羽 阅读(171) 评论(0) 推荐(0)
上一页 1 ··· 8 9 10 11 12 13 14 15 16 ··· 26 下一页